After leaving the Australian Outback to get an education, Emily Tempest--half-aboriginal, half-white--returns to her birthplace as an Aboriginal County Police officer. Emily's first assignment is a murder at the Green Swamp Well Roadhouse, a case that seems open-and-shut to her partner, by-the-book Sergeant Cockburn. But the suspect is an old friend of Emily's father, a prospector with a passion for philosophy. Could he really have committed this heinous crime?
